Modified Transosseous Wiring Technique for Neglected Fracture–Dislocation of the Proximal Interphalangeal Joint
BACKGROUND: Fracture–dislocation of the proximal interphalangeal (PIP) joint of the finger is challenging due to the high risk of stiffness.
